NullReferenceException at CheckSourceInventoryError

Im getting this on console...not very frequently but enought.

Calling 'ccTradeAccept' on 'Trade v1.2.42' took 474ms Failed to call hook 'ccTradeAccept' on plugin 'Trade v1.2.42' (NullReferenceException: Object reference not set to an instance of an object)
at Oxide.Plugins.Trade.CheckSourceInventory (Oxide.Plugins.Trade+OpenTrade t) [0x00000] in <8598b2535e9b4af18520fe6122cb8c39>:0
at Oxide.Plugins.Trade.TradeAccept (BasePlayer player) [0x00041] in <8598b2535e9b4af18520fe6122cb8c39>:0
at Oxide.Plugins.Trade.ccTradeAccept (ConsoleSystem+Arg arg) [0x00034] in <8598b2535e9b4af18520fe6122cb8c39>:0
at Oxide.Plugins.Trade.DirectCallHook (System.String name, System.Object& ret, System.Object[] args) [0x00c32] in <8598b2535e9b4af18520fe6122cb8c39>:0
at Oxide.Plugins.CSharpPlugin.InvokeMethod (Oxide.Core.Plugins.HookMethod method, System.Object[] args) [0x00079] in <98321e516fc1420ea57d4d2088213a59>:0 at Oxide.Core.Plugins.CSPlugin.OnCallHook (System.String name, System.Object[] args) [0x000d8] in :0
at Oxide.Core.Plugins.Plugin.CallHook (System.String hook, System.Object[] args) [0x00060] in :0
same - still no response....
Failed to call hook 'ccTradeAccept' on plugin 'Trade v1.2.42' (NullReferenceException: Object reference not set to an instance of an object)
  at Oxide.Plugins.Trade.CheckSourceInventory (Oxide.Plugins.Trade+OpenTrade t) [0x00000] in <8ca3befc051d487e892cd9ca2b38cb00>:0 
  at Oxide.Plugins.Trade.TradeAccept (BasePlayer player) [0x00041] in <8ca3befc051d487e892cd9ca2b38cb00>:0 
  at Oxide.Plugins.Trade.ccTradeAccept (ConsoleSystem+Arg arg) [0x00034] in <8ca3befc051d487e892cd9ca2b38cb00>:0 
  at Oxide.Plugins.Trade.DirectCallHook (System.String name, System.Object& ret, System.Object[] args) [0x00c32] in <8ca3befc051d487e892cd9ca2b38cb00>:0 
  at Oxide.Plugins.CSharpPlugin.InvokeMethod (Oxide.Core.Plugins.HookMethod method, System.Object[] args) [0x00079] in <008b12f41ec4452da1a5497eeb849299>:0 
  at Oxide.Core.Plugins.CSPlugin.OnCallHook (System.String name, System.Object[] args) [0x000d8] in <ac41dd3599754d448b8c218b34645820>:0 
  at Oxide.Core.Plugins.Plugin.CallHook (System.String hook, System.Object[] args) [0x00060] in <ac41dd3599754d448b8c218b34645820>:0
(12:46:15) | Failed to call hook 'ccTradeAccept' on plugin 'Trade v1.2.42' (NullReferenceException: Object reference not set to an instance of an object)
at Oxide.Plugins.Trade.CheckSourceInventory (Oxide.Plugins.Trade+OpenTrade t) [0x00000] in <ed2817ddd14b4350b4addc9049212075>:0
at Oxide.Plugins.Trade.TradeAccept (BasePlayer player) [0x00041] in <ed2817ddd14b4350b4addc9049212075>:0
at Oxide.Plugins.Trade.ccTradeAccept (ConsoleSystem+Arg arg) [0x00034] in <ed2817ddd14b4350b4addc9049212075>:0
at Oxide.Plugins.Trade.DirectCallHook (System.String name, System.Object& ret, System.Object[] args) [0x00c32] in <ed2817ddd14b4350b4addc9049212075>:0
at Oxide.Plugins.CSharpPlugin.InvokeMethod (Oxide.Core.Plugins.HookMethod method, System.Object[] args) [0x00079] in <008b12f41ec4452da1a5497eeb849299>:0
at Oxide.Core.Plugins.CSPlugin.OnCallHook (System.String name, System.Object[] args) [0x000d8] in <ac41dd3599754d448b8c218b34645820>:0
at Oxide.Core.Plugins.Plugin.CallHook (System.String hook, System.Object[] args) [0x00060] in <ac41dd3599754d448b8c218b34645820>:
Failed to call hook 'ccTradeAccept' on plugin 'Trade v1.2.42' (NullReferenceException: Object reference not set to an instance of an object)
at Oxide.Plugins.Trade.CheckSourceInventory (Oxide.Plugins.Trade+OpenTrade t) [0x00000] in <b46ae661a0f04f9caaf1e4a906b48fe6>:0
at Oxide.Plugins.Trade.TradeAccept (BasePlayer player) [0x00041] in <b46ae661a0f04f9caaf1e4a906b48fe6>:0
at Oxide.Plugins.Trade.ccTradeAccept (ConsoleSystem+Arg arg) [0x00034] in <b46ae661a0f04f9caaf1e4a906b48fe6>:0
at Oxide.Plugins.Trade.DirectCallHook (System.String name, System.Object& ret, System.Object[] args) [0x00c32] in <b46ae661a0f04f9caaf1e4a906b48fe6>:0
at Oxide.Plugins.CSharpPlugin.InvokeMethod (Oxide.Core.Plugins.HookMethod method, System.Object[] args) [0x00079] in <8a646463979e4a1d9c0e2f1298e9483f>:0
at Oxide.Core.Plugins.CSPlugin.OnCallHook (System.String name, System.Object[] args) [0x000d8] in <953329caf7d943cc9eca5c8b4b890c98>:0
at Oxide.Core.Plugins.Plugin.CallHook (System.String hook, System.Object[] args) [0x00060] in <953329caf7d943cc9eca5c8b4b890c98>:0
Okay, is this happening for every item or a specific item?
everything
Failed to call hook 'ccTradeAccept' on plugin 'Trade v1.2.42' (NullReferenceException: Object reference not set to an instance of an object)
  at Oxide.Plugins.Trade.CheckTargetInventory (Oxide.Plugins.Trade+OpenTrade t) [0x00010] in <262c55fae864474fad3e90e97639cd5a>:0 
  at Oxide.Plugins.Trade.TradeAccept (BasePlayer player) [0x0006b] in <262c55fae864474fad3e90e97639cd5a>:0 
  at Oxide.Plugins.Trade.ccTradeAccept (ConsoleSystem+Arg arg) [0x00034] in <262c55fae864474fad3e90e97639cd5a>:0 
  at Oxide.Plugins.Trade.DirectCallHook (System.String name, System.Object& ret, System.Object[] args) [0x00c32] in <262c55fae864474fad3e90e97639cd5a>:0 
  at Oxide.Plugins.CSharpPlugin.InvokeMethod (Oxide.Core.Plugins.HookMethod method, System.Object[] args) [0x00079] in :0 
  at Oxide.Core.Plugins.CSPlugin.OnCallHook (System.String name, System.Object[] args) [0x000d8] in :0 
  at Oxide.Core.Plugins.Plugin.CallHook (System.String hook, System.Object[] args) [0x00060] in :0 
Failed to call hook 'ccTradeAccept' on plugin 'Trade v1.2.42' (NullReferenceException: Object reference not set to an instance of an object)
  at Oxide.Plugins.Trade.CheckSourceInventory (Oxide.Plugins.Trade+OpenTrade t) [0x00000] in <89dc22bb9e2e472eb49258619936e2c8>:0
  at Oxide.Plugins.Trade.TradeAccept (BasePlayer player) [0x00041] in <89dc22bb9e2e472eb49258619936e2c8>:0
  at Oxide.Plugins.Trade.ccTradeAccept (ConsoleSystem+Arg arg) [0x00034] in <89dc22bb9e2e472eb49258619936e2c8>:0
  at Oxide.Plugins.Trade.DirectCallHook (System.String name, System.Object& ret, System.Object[] args) [0x00c32] in <89dc22bb9e2e472eb49258619936e2c8>:0
  at Oxide.Plugins.CSharpPlugin.InvokeMethod (Oxide.Core.Plugins.HookMethod method, System.Object[] args) [0x00079] in <80b90e8213db44b29ec2d4111764172c>:0
  at Oxide.Core.Plugins.CSPlugin.OnCallHook (System.String name, System.Object[] args) [0x000d8] in <ec05e0208c9149bba43236ca58fea105>:0
  at Oxide.Core.Plugins.Plugin.CallHook (System.String hook, System.Object[] args) [0x00060] in <ec05e0208c9149bba43236ca58fea105>:0


Merged post

No idea.......

Since it is the user
You don't know what they are trading.... you only have log files
maybe start with some sort of "debug" that says who is trading with who?
and WHEN, this could have been miutes or hours ago....

Failed to call hook 'ccTradeAccept' on plugin 'Trade v1.2.43' (NullReferenceException: Object reference not set to an instance of an object)
  at Oxide.Plugins.Trade.CheckSourceInventory (Oxide.Plugins.Trade+OpenTrade t) [0x00000] in <30efef18a93142089a475243a6ddbfcd>:0
  at Oxide.Plugins.Trade.TradeAccept (BasePlayer player) [0x00041] in <30efef18a93142089a475243a6ddbfcd>:0
  at Oxide.Plugins.Trade.ccTradeAccept (ConsoleSystem+Arg arg) [0x00034] in <30efef18a93142089a475243a6ddbfcd>:0
  at Oxide.Plugins.Trade.DirectCallHook (System.String name, System.Object& ret, System.Object[] args) [0x00c32] in <30efef18a93142089a475243a6ddbfcd>:0
  at Oxide.Plugins.CSharpPlugin.InvokeMethod (Oxide.Core.Plugins.HookMethod method, System.Object[] args) [0x00079] in <31122a27a2414cd799150f8677cf39d4>:0
at Oxide.Core.Plugins.CSPlugin.OnCallHook (System.String name, System.Object[] args) [0x000d8] in

Happens when a client accepts a trade offer.

players lost items when they try to trade

(15:58:20) | Failed to call hook 'ccTradeAccept' on plugin 'Trade v1.2.43' (NullReferenceException: Object reference not set to an instance of an object)

at Oxide.Plugins.Trade.CheckSourceInventory (Oxide.Plugins.Trade+OpenTrade t) [0x00000] in <724ae35568674852a144d8c1278b60b5>:0

at Oxide.Plugins.Trade.TradeAccept (BasePlayer player) [0x00041] in <724ae35568674852a144d8c1278b60b5>:0

at Oxide.Plugins.Trade.ccTradeAccept (ConsoleSystem+Arg arg) [0x00034] in <724ae35568674852a144d8c1278b60b5>:0

at Oxide.Plugins.Trade.DirectCallHook (System.String name, System.Object& ret, System.Object[] args) [0x00c32] in <724ae35568674852a144d8c1278b60b5>:0

at Oxide.Plugins.CSharpPlugin.InvokeMethod (Oxide.Core.Plugins.HookMethod method, System.Object[] args) [0x00079] in <60c318df79ed41688ea59335e48d61ad>:0

at Oxide.Core.Plugins.CSPlugin.OnCallHook (System.String name, System.Object[] args) [0x000d8] in <12678b905a6d43c3a9cc366104306651>:0

at Oxide.Core.Plugins.Plugin.CallHook (System.String hook, System.Object[] args) [0x00060] in <12678b905a6d43c3a9cc366104306651>:0